how do you turn the planes sounds up?

Post by sandi »

Hi, bought the 250 yesterday, and i am semi-sure it works. when i say as i do, it is because, there is no engine sounds when i fire it up, I have the same problem with the cub all of the internal sounds are off, too.
Question, since i can’t use the menus in the sim, are there a file somewhere on the hard drive that controls the sound volumes i can edit?

Hi Sandi,

The internal sound effects (The Accu-Sim sounds) should play through whichever audio device you have set up as default in MS Windows itself. Note that this can be different to the device you've got assigned in the FSX sound setting window. Unlike with most FSX aircraft, the internal sounds effects aren't .wav files but instead they're encoded in a "Sounds.pk" file which can't be edited by the end user as far as I'm aware.

However, the volume of these Accu-Sim sounds can be controlled independently through the shift 3 pop-up menu. There's a volume control at the lower left just below the 'auto start' option, so to increase the volume to max you'd want to click the '+' a few times to make sure the slim grey bar extends across the box. The "Comanche Input Configurator" allow you to assign custom axis and key commands to various controls. The "Comanche 250 Aircraft Configurator" is a different tool which lets you integrate third-party add-on GPS units into the cockpit and use custom landing light effects.

sandi wrote:You are talking about a plus sign, when the pluss sign is on the right menu, will your arrow keys lower or raise the sound?
No, I think the only way to adjust the volume is by actual mouse clicks on the menu itself. I think you'd need to do some additional programming with FSUIPC to be able to change the volume with key presses. By default it should already be at max though, so if you've no internal sound effects, you probably just need to check to see what your default playback device in Windows is.

As far as the sim variables go, the A2A developers created a lot of custom code to simulate various aspects of the aircraft's engine, systems and avionics. Because of this, it's generally necessary to use software such as FSUIPC4 to access the custom local panel variables (L:Vars) which they have defined.
